**Q: How do we cut over the Tallowmere billing worker between blue and green?**

Drain the blue pool first, confirm zero in-flight invoices, then shift the queue binding to green. Never run both pools against the ledger simultaneously — double-charging risk. If cutover stalls, the rollback console requires authentication with the passphrase noted below.

unlock words, bahop-fawef: novmir-druwyn-soriel-rusdor-kasion

**Q: How do we regain admin access to a ChipGate timing reader if the operator badge is lost mid-race?**

A: ChipGate readers lock their admin interface after badge loss is reported. The reader keeps recording splits; only configuration is frozen. Security reviewers should verify the lockout event appears in the audit trail before any recovery attempt. Once verified, the reader's maintenance port will accept the recovery passphrase below.

unlock words, kajeg-fahif: holmir-casael-novdor

## Local Setup

The Harrowlight service places a bloom filter in front of the Kivet key-value store to avoid pointless lookups for absent keys. On first boot, the filter is rebuilt from a full key scan, which can take several minutes on larger datasets; set `BLOOM_SKIP_WARM=1` during development to start with an empty filter instead. Note that false-positive rates above 2% will trigger a warning in the logs. The service populates the filter by reading keys from the database at the connection string below.

replica DSN, kajep-yahag: mssql://praok_svc:iF@db-8d68.plorvaio.local:5432/eliion